Crew: Two Make Ready But One to Go

Most top college crews have a calm, tree-edged river or lake to paddle around in, a well-appointed boathouse to change in, and money from old grads for new equipment. Not so the University of California at Berkeley. One of Coach Jim Lemmon's shells has been around for 29 years and the building his eights call home was built in 1925. His practice course? It would probably be easier to row through Times Square.
